John Gill's Exposition on Joshua 21:25

And out of the half tribe of Manasseh, Taanach with her suburbs, etc.] Of which (see <061710>Joshua 17:10); and Gathrimmon with her suburbs, there was a city of this name in Dan, as in (<062124>Joshua 21:24); nor was it unusual for cities to be called by the same name in different tribes: two cities; these are called Aner and Bilean in (<130670>1 Chronicles 6:70); in process of time cities changed their names; two cities were a proper proportion for this half tribe; two more were given out of the other half tribe on the other side Jordan, as appears by what follows.
